> Marine Crankshaft in Santa Anna, CA has a "5 main" crankshaft patterned.
He's made at least 6 so far. They are a thing of beauty and 4 lbs lighter than
stock. I'll attach a photo but it will be stripped on the FoT cc. A little
grinding on the webs in the block is required for clearance.
